WebFeb 10, 2024 · If a partial clog is causing your toilet’s low water levels, one of the best ways to tell is by observing how the toilet flushes. If the water levels rise to the top of your toilet only to slowly go down until water levels are below normal, chances are this siphoning issue is somewhere in the trap of your toilet. WebMultiple slow-running drains and low water pressure in your home also suggest a sewer line issue. Water in strange places. If you have a fountain of water pouring from your shower head when using the washing machine or water comes up in the tub when you flush the toilet, heed our fount of wisdom: it may mean your sewer line is clogged. WebFeb 23, 2024 · Most likely, the problem is a clog in your toilet. Non-flushable objects like baby wipes get stuck in the pipes, preventing your toilet from draining fast. The other two factors leading to the slow toilet drainage include clogged rim jets and a low water level in the tank. Let’s see how you can solve all of these issues.

The solution is to drain the tank and bowl, check … WebShutoff the water to the toilet. Flush the toilet to empty the tank (doesn't have to be completely empty, but you want some working space). Open the valve by lifting the float to the top position, pressing down on the black plastic cap that covers the valve, and giving it a 1/8 to 1/4 turn. You should then be able to lift the cap directly off.
